It Takes Two with Lianne McCray presents:

Why eating is so hard for AuDHers, and how to make it easier.
Online event
Sunday, July 19Β  β€’Β  3–5 p.m.

This workshop is all about how being Autistic, ADHD, having ARFID (or all of the above or other traits of various neuro-divergences) can impact our ability to eat. Answering the age-old question: "Why does food have to be so freakin' hard??" we'll demystify what exactly is causing the stress, enjoy being in community with others who understand, and talk about potential strategies to help you be well-fed, spend less time stressing about food, and have more time and energy for the things you love.

What We'll Cover

You may struggle in any or all of these areas:

  • Acquiring & Prepping: Getting Food on the Table
  • Recognizing & Responding to Hunger Cues
  • Social & Emotional Factors relating to food & eating
  • The Sensory Experience of Food and Eating

In this workshop we'll delve into why/how all of the above make food and eating difficult, and highlight potential solutions and ways to address each one.

PLUS we'll explore how you can:

  • Manage & conserve your energy
  • Work WITH your brain
  • Be kind to yourself
  • Communicate your needs
